Key Responsibilities

  • Perform comprehensive evaluations for patients with lymphedema
  • Develop and implement individualized plans of care
  • Provide Complete Decongestive Therapy (CDT) including:
    • Manual lymphatic drainage (MLD)
    • Compression bandaging and garment education
    • Skin care education
    • Therapeutic exercise
  • Educate patients and caregivers on self-management techniques
  • Accurately document care in the EMR
  • Communicate with physicians and interdisciplinary care teams
  • Ensure compliance with home health regulations and agency standards
  • Assess, treat, and monitor skin integrity issues and wounds commonly associated with lymphedema, including:
    • Weeping edema
    • Venous stasis ulcers
    • Pressure injuries
    • Moisture-associated skin damage (MASD)
    • Cellulitis prevention and early identification
  • Perform basic to moderate wound care as ordered, including cleansing, dressing selection, and compression-compatible wound management as it pertains to lymphedema
